In the budget, on the reduction in the allocation for Rural Employment Guarantee Scheme ie MGNREGA, it has been said by the government that MGNREGA employment will be compensated by the employment generated through Jal Jeevan Mission and PM Awas Yojana. For the financial year 2024, the government has allocated a total of Rs 60,000 crore for MNREGA.
The central government has cut the budget for the purchase of food grains from farmers during the financial year 2023-24. A budget of Rs 59793 crore has been announced for the purchase of food grains in the financial year 2023-24, whereas for the financial year 2022-23 this budget is Rs 72282 crore. The Center gives this money to the states to buy food grains from the farmers.
